Tests show high levels of arsenic near TVA coal plant
Found: 5 Days 11 Hours 48 Minutes ago Knoxville News Sentinel - A coalition of environmental groups said Thursday that water quality tests near the spot where 1.1 billion gallons of coal fly ash spilled into the Emory River near Kingston have turned up levels of heavy metals up to 300 times higher than regulatory limits.
